Re: Map making - Alwarren - 01-25-2016

(01-25-2016, 02:14 AM)treendy link Wrote: I will be happy to draw out the map myself, adding hills etc... instead of using a heightmap... (like the terrain editor in unity3D if anyone has tried it)... or is the only option using height maps

Personally, I don't think that will be very realistic. I do know Zargabad was done in Blender using sculpting, but I believe he still worked with a height map as raw material.

I really would recommend using either real satellite data, or L3DT or similar program.
